  1. Battery Capacity:
    Battery capacity refers to the energy storage of the bike’s battery, usually measured in watt-hours (Wh). A higher capacity allows longer travel distances on a single charge. For example, a bike with a 500 Wh battery can typically manage around 40-70 miles on a single charge, depending on riding conditions and assist levels.

  2. Motor Power:
    Motor power is measured in watts (W) and indicates how much assistance the motor provides. Common options are 250W and 750W. A 250W motor is efficient for flat terrains and short distances, while a 750W motor is suitable for steep hills and longer rides. As per the Class 1, Class 2, and Class 3 definitions, understanding motor classifications can inform legal usage on bike paths.

  3. Bike Weight:
    Bike weight affects speed and handling. Electric bikes generally weigh between 40 to 70 pounds. Lighter bikes are easier to maneuver but may have smaller batteries and motors. A heavier bike, on the other hand, might offer more features but could be cumbersome during parking or carrying.

  4. Frame Design:
    Frame design impacts comfort and stability. Common styles include step-through and diamond frames. A step-through design offers easier mounting and dismounting, which is beneficial for commuting in urban settings.

  5. Safety Features:
    Safety features include integrated lights, reflective materials, and brakes. High-quality brakes, like hydraulic disc brakes, provide better stopping power under various weather conditions. Some bikes also offer anti-lock brakes and smart lights that enhance visibility.

  6. Tires and Suspension:
    Tires and suspension types determine comfort and stability. Wider tires with more tread enhance grip on different surfaces, while suspension forks can absorb shocks, making rides smoother on uneven terrain.

  7. Price and Warranty:
    Price varies widely based on features and brand reputation. A typical commuter electric bike can range from $1,000 to over $3,000. Warranty offers for the bike and battery can indicate manufacturer confidence and potential longevity, typically lasting from one to five years.

  8. Smart Technology Integrations:
    Smart technology can enhance your experience. Many bikes feature GPS tracking, Bluetooth connectivity, and theft alarms. These features improve navigation and security.

  9. Folding Capability:
    Folding bikes are ideal for those with limited storage space. They can be compactly folded for easy transport on public transport or in small apartments. Consider the ease of folding mechanisms, as some models offer quicker assemblies than others.

What Common Drawbacks Should You Be Aware of with Commuter Electric Bikes?

Commuter electric bikes have several common drawbacks that potential users should consider.

  1. Limited range
  2. Heavy weight
  3. Higher initial cost
  4. Maintenance needs
  5. Battery lifespan concerns
  6. Charging time
  7. Weather dependency
  8. Regulatory restrictions

The following factors provide insights into each of these drawbacks associated with commuter electric bikes.

  1. Limited range: Limited range refers to the distance an electric bike can travel on a single charge. Most commuter electric bikes typically have a range of 20 to 50 miles, depending on battery capacity and usage. According to a survey by Electric Bike Report in 2023, users reported that insufficient range can limit longer commutes or trips. Riders may need to recharge more frequently than desired.

  2. Heavy weight: Heavy weight denotes the overall mass of electric bikes, which can be 20 to 50 pounds heavier than traditional bikes due to their battery and motor. A study by Bike Radar in 2022 found that heavier bikes can be cumbersome to transport, particularly in hilly areas or during manual handling situations, like carrying them up stairs.

  3. Higher initial cost: Higher initial cost indicates the upfront expenditure required to purchase a commuter electric bike. Prices typically range from $900 to over $5,000, as noted by Consumer Reports in 2023. This expense can deter potential users despite savings on fuel or public transportation costs over time.

  4. Maintenance needs: Maintenance needs refer to the ongoing care and servicing required for electric bikes. These bikes may require specialized maintenance for the battery and electrical components. A report from eBikeChoices in 2023 highlighted that such requirements could result in unexpected expenses and time commitments for owners.

  5. Battery lifespan concerns: Battery lifespan concerns involve the degradation of the battery over time. Most electric bike batteries last from 2 to 5 years, depending on usage and care. The Electric Bike Association states that battery replacements can be costly, often needing $500 or more, which can impact long-term budget planning.

  6. Charging time: Charging time signifies the duration needed to recharge an electric bike’s battery fully. Many models require 4 to 8 hours for a complete charge, as reported by Bike Europe in 2022. This delay can inconvenience users, especially those who rely on their bike for daily commuting.

  7. Weather dependency: Weather dependency indicates that adverse weather conditions can affect the usability and safety of commuter electric bikes. Rain, snow, and ice can pose significant risks for riders and may deter use altogether. A study conducted by the Institute for Transportation and Development Policy in 2023 noted that inclement weather is a significant barrier to electric bike adoption.

  8. Regulatory restrictions: Regulatory restrictions encompass various laws governing electric bike usage in different jurisdictions. Some areas have specific limits on speed, power, or rider age. According to the League of American Bicyclists, regulations may restrict where electric bikes can be parked or ridden, which could limit their practicality for commuters.
